The IELTS Examination: A Brief Overview
Before diving into the problem of acquiring IELTS certificates, it is important to comprehend the nature of the test itself. IELTS is jointly managed by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The test is designed to examine the language abilities of non-native English speakers in 4 key locations: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. It is available in 2 formats: Academic, which appropriates for those using to higher education or professional institutions, and General Training, which is more suited for those moving to English-speaking countries for work experience or training programs.
The IELTS test is strenuous and requires prospects to show their capability to comprehend, interact, and use English efficiently in various contexts. The test is usually conducted over one day, and outcomes are usually readily available within 13 days. The IELTS score stands for 2 years, after which prospects may require to retake the test to demonstrate their continued efficiency.

Ethical Considerations
Fairness and Integrity: The integrity of the IELTS test is constructed on the concept of fairness. Acquiring a certificate weakens this concept by supplying an unjust benefit to those who can pay for to buy it, while disadvantaging those who work hard to make their ratings honestly.Individual Growth: The process of preparing for and taking the IELTS test is an important knowing experience. It helps candidates enhance their English abilities, which are necessary for success in their academic and professional endeavors. Buying a certificate robs individuals of this opportunity for personal development.
Legal Implications
Scams: Purchasing an IELTS certificate is a kind of academic scams. It is unlawful and can result in extreme repercussions, including legal action, the revocation of admission or task offers, and damage to one's reputation.Penalties: Educational organizations and companies have stringent policies against academic dishonesty. If a prospect is discovered to have bought a certificate, they may face expulsion, termination, or other penalties.
Practical Consequences
Language Proficiency: The IELTS test is designed to evaluate a prospect's actual language abilities. If a prospect purchases a certificate, they will not be able to show the needed efficiency when they are in a real-world circumstance, such as in a classroom or a work environment. This can cause considerable problems and might even compromise their security.Long-Term Impact: The consequences of buying a certificate can be long-lasting. The companies that administer the IELTS test have robust systems in location to identify and avoid fraud. Here are some of the measures they use:
Verification of Test Results: Educational organizations and companies can verify IELTS scores through the main IELTS site. This process includes cross-checking the candidate's details and the test center info.Biometric Identification: Many IELTS test centers utilize biometric identification, such as finger prints or facial recognition, to ensure that the person taking the test is the same person who will get the certificate.Test Center Monitoring: Test centers are kept track of to guarantee that all prospects follow the rules and that the test is conducted fairly.
